A. Cual De Las Siguientes Medidas No Se Debería Escribir En Notación Científica:

Números De Estrellas En Una Galaxia, Números De Granos De Arena En Una Playa, Velocidad De Un Carro O Población De Un País


B. el numero o,9 x 10 elevado a la menos 5 esta escrito correctamente en notación científica ¿por que?


C. Que diferencia hay en el exponente de la potencia de 10 cuando escribes un numero entre o y 1 en notación científica y cuando escribes un numero mayor que uno en notación científica

1 Answer

3 votes

Answer:

A.

Scientific notation is used to express large numbers into a smaller expression without losing important aspects of the number and its representation. Examples of large numbers are: the number of stars in a galaxy, the numbers of grain sands on a beach, the popoulation of a country.

However, the speed of a car doesn't need scientific notation, beacuse it can't be a large number.

Therefore, the right asnwer here is "Velocidad de un Carro".

B.

The given number is
0.9 * 10^(-5).

This number is not correct, because, according to the rules of scientific notations, the coefficient of the power must be from 1 to 9, and here we have 0.9, which is out of such interval.
